Aruba experts?

I'm looking to stay in Aruba next winter for a week. I've pretty much concluded I will stay on either Eagle or Palm beach. Are there any well informed travelers who can say which is superior and why? I really could use some first hand info.

Well, that has been an ongoing debate for years now between Arubaphiles (new word lol!). We spend most of the year in Aruba and are on Eagle Beach. Eagle Beach is the low rises and Palm Beach is very much more busy and has the high rise hotels, The Radisson, Westin, Marriott, Hyatt etc. It really depends on what you're looking for - what you like! For really good info from a diverse group check out forums at www.aruba-bb.com and www.aruba.com. We prefer Eagle Beach and, specifically, Costa Linda Beach Resort (primarily timeshare but they rent - mostly 2 bedrooms with 16 3 bedroom units). It has a very large beach and is really very nice. We go to the highrises for some of the restaurants and, when in season, it reminds DH of downtown Hyannis on Labor Day weekend.

playa linda

the time share resort that would most likely fulfill your requests would be playa linda. its on the beach within a 3 minute walk are a few casinos and lots of restaurants.
studio is a little bigger than a hotel room with a small kitchen alcov
1br has full eat in kitchen with large table living room and seperate br
2br 2 bathrooms 2 brs kitchen living room
all units come with a nice balcony
